Beatles Tribute Band To Launch Fab Four Exhibit At Wheaton Library

Kaleidoscope Eyes will perform Beatles tunes at West Plaza on Oct. 9 to celebrate Wheaton Library's "4EVER4: 60 Years of the Beatles."

WHEATON, IL — Wheaton Public Library will launch its month-long "4EVER4: 60 Years of the Beatles" exhibit with a Beatles tribute performance by Kaleidoscope Eyes slated for Oct. 9. The concert will be held outdoors at 2 p.m. at West Plaza, if weather permits.

The "4EVER4: 60 Years of the Beatles" exhibit will fill the library's main floor with close to 100 photographs of the Beatles. The photos depict some of the Fab Four's performances, along with some memorabilia and behind-the-scenes images of their tours.

The exhibit runs through Oct. 30.

On Oct. 11 at 7 p.m., historian John F. Lyons will present "60 Years of the Beatles," chronicling the group's time in Chicago through music, photographs, videos and stories.
